We dig into what most people want—some form of fit, secure, and fulfilled—and why knowledge is not the barrier anymore. We define the terms on our own, then show how application, discipline, and consistency turn plans into identity and results.• defining fit, wealth, and happiness in clear personal terms• why knowledge access is not the bottleneck• application as the missing link between goals and change• discipline as temporary discomfort for future gain• consistency, compounding, and micro wins• avoiding comparison and protecting momentum• a simple challenge to move from knowing to doingStop being a knowledge junkie—start applying with discipline and consistencyhttps://aarondegler.com/
